What Are Dental Veneers

A small shell bonded to a tooth can transform both function and outer appearance. Dental veneers are ultra-thin restorations made from porcelain or composite resin. They cover the front surface teeth to mask chips, stains, and mild misalignment.

porcelain veneers

Porcelain vs Composite Resin

Porcelain veneers resist stains and mimic the translucency of natural teeth. They last longer and often give a more authentic look.

Composite resin shells cost less and can be applied in one visit. They work well for small repairs like chips or minor cavities.

“Porcelain provides durability and a lifelike shine; composite is quicker and more affordable.”

Material Durability Look Best For
Porcelain High (10–15 years) Very natural; mimics enamel Long-term aesthetic corrections
Composite resin Moderate (5–7 years) Good; slightly less translucent Quick fixes; minor chips and cavities
Temporary veneers Short-term Functional but not final Trial or interim protection

Analyzing the Cost of Celebrity Veneers

Choosing where to get veneers begins with a clear look at how prices differ across markets. High-end celebrity veneers can range from $2,500 to $4,500 per tooth, reflecting elite skills and premium materials.

By contrast, quality porcelain options in Turkey often cost between $250 and $500 per tooth. Many people — including some public figures — travel for treatment to reduce overall expense while still seeking strong results.

The total price for a full set depends on the number of teeth treated, the type of veneer, and additional procedures. Porcelain veneers usually cost more but last longer and mimic natural enamel for several years.

FAQ

What is meant by a celebrity-style smile and why do public figures choose it?

A celebrity-style smile refers to a highly polished, symmetric set of front teeth often achieved with veneers or whitening. Public figures choose this look to boost camera appeal, maintain a consistent public image, and correct issues like stains, gaps, or worn enamel… The treatment can enhance confidence and help with branding in music, film, and sports.

What are dental veneers and how do they work?

Veneers are thin shells bonded to the front surface of teeth to change color, shape, or alignment. They mask imperfections such as chips, gaps, or discoloration. Porcelain veneers mimic light reflection better than composite resin and tend to last longer, while composite resin is less invasive and often costs less.

Porcelain vs composite resin — which material is better?

Porcelain offers superior translucency and stain resistance, giving a more natural, long-lasting appearance. Composite resin is more affordable, repairable, and requires less tooth removal. The best choice depends on budget, desired longevity, and the extent of cosmetic change needed.

What are the main benefits of cosmetic dentistry beyond aesthetics?

Beyond appearance, cosmetic dentistry can improve bite function, protect weakened enamel, close gaps that trap food, and make oral hygiene easier. Improved dental function often leads to better speech and chewing comfort, contributing to overall oral health.

How long do veneers typically last?

Porcelain veneers generally last 10–15 years or longer with good care; composite resin lasts about 5–7 years. Longevity depends on oral hygiene, grinding or clenching habits, diet, and regular dental checkups.

Do veneers damage natural teeth?

Modern veneer techniques aim to preserve tooth structure, but some enamel removal is often required for porcelain. Well-planned treatment minimizes risk. A qualified cosmetic dentist will evaluate tooth health and recommend conservative options when possible.

Can veneers be used to correct gaps and minor alignment issues?

Yes. Veneers can close small gaps, change tooth proportions, and mask mild alignment problems. For significant spacing or severe crowding, orthodontic treatment may be a better long-term solution.

How much do celebrity-grade veneers cost and why are they expensive?

Costs vary widely by region and provider. High-end porcelain veneers crafted by master ceramists cost more due to material quality, lab work, and detailed color matching. Celebrity cases often include multiple restorations and follow-up work, increasing the price.

Are there differences in treatment cost between local and international clinics?

Yes. Treatment prices can be lower in some countries due to labor and overhead differences, but patients should weigh travel, follow-up care, warranty support, and quality standards. Research credentials, patient reviews, and before/after photos before choosing care abroad.

How do dentists ensure veneers look natural and suit a person’s face?

Dentists use digital imaging, mock-ups, and shade guides to design veneers that match skin tone, lip shape, and facial proportions. Good cosmetic work balances tooth size, color, and symmetry with the patient’s personality and features for a bespoke result.

Can veneers appear too white or fake like some celebrity cases?

Overly bright veneers often result from poor shade selection or exaggerated design. A skilled team will avoid an unrealistic look by selecting appropriate translucency and color nuances. Communicating personal preferences is crucial to avoid an artificial appearance.

What are common complications or “bad veneer” cases seen in the spotlight?

Problems include poor fit, mismatched color, overcontouring, premature failure, and gum irritation. Inadequate planning or inexperienced providers can cause these issues. Choosing a reputable cosmetic dentist reduces risk.

How should someone choose the right cosmetic dentist for veneer work?

Look for credentials in cosmetic dentistry, a strong portfolio of before/after photos, patient testimonials, and clear treatment planning. Ask about materials, laboratory partners, and maintenance protocols. A consultation should include conservative options and realistic outcomes.

Do insurance plans cover veneer treatments?

Most dental insurance considers veneers cosmetic and does not cover them. If a veneer restores function after damage, partial coverage might apply. Verify policy details and ask the dental office about financing options.

How do celebrities maintain their veneers and oral health between treatments?

Maintenance includes twice-daily brushing with nonabrasive toothpaste, flossing, routine checkups, and using a night guard if they grind teeth. Avoiding staining foods and limiting smoking helps preserve color and surface integrity.

Can veneers be repaired if chipped or damaged?

Minor chips in composite veneers can often be repaired chairside. Porcelain repairs may require replacement of the veneer. Prompt attention to damage reduces the likelihood of further complications.

Are there non-veneer alternatives to achieve a brighter, more aligned look?

Alternatives include professional whitening, orthodontic treatments like clear aligners, bonding, and crowns. Each option suits different needs; a dentist can recommend the least invasive and most effective approach for the individual.

How long does the veneer treatment process take from consultation to final placement?

Typical porcelain veneer workflows take 2–4 weeks: consultation and planning, tooth preparation and impressions, lab fabrication, and final bonding. Composite veneers can be completed in a single visit in many cases.
